Current shareholders can subscribe to the new Series B stock at 50 pesos (or US$5) per share. Shares are now trading on the Mexican Stock Exchange at 38 pesos (US$3.80).
Shares not purchased will go to the company’s treasury and be used for future acquisitions, mergers and debt reduction.
With 630 million shares outstanding, Grupo Mexico it is still considering seeking a listing on the New York Stock Exchange.
The company recently completed a US$2.2-billion takeover of Asarco, a major copper producer.
The acquisition doubled Groupo Mexico’s production to nearly 2 billion lbs. annually.
